#bd736f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d736f is composed of 74.1% red, 45.1%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.2%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 3.1 degrees, a saturation of 37.1% and a lightness of 58.8%. #bd736f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6de with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#bd736f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d736f has RGB values of R:189, G:115,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.41,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12415855.

Shades and Tints of #bd736f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d736f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d908f is the less saturated color, while #fe392e is the most saturated one.
